Autoimmunity is the system of immune responses of an organism against its own healthy cells and tissues. Any disease that results from such an aberrant immune response is termed an "autoimmune disease". Prominent examples include celiac disease, diabetes mellitus type 1, sarcoidosis, syst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E), Sjögren's syndrome, eosinophilic granulomatosis with polyangiitis, Hashimoto's thyroiditis, Graves' disease, idiopathic thrombocytopenic purpura, Addison's disease, rheumatoid arthritis (RA), ankylosing spondylitis, polymyositis (PM), dermatomyositis (DM) and multiple sclerosis (MS). Autoimmune diseases are very often treated with steroids.

A method for constructing an experimental autoimmune prostatitis rat model

The application relates to a method for constructing an experimental autoimmune prostatitis rat model, which comprises the following steps: S1, preparing a prostate specific antigen mixture; S2, selecting male SD rats as experimental rats and dividing the rats into a physiological saline control group, a low-dose model group and a high-dose model group; S3, continuously injecting for 7 days, wherein the physiological saline control group receives 0.2ml of physiological saline injection every day, the low-dose model group receives 0.1ml of the prostate specific antigen mixture injection every day, and the high-dose model group receives 0.2ml of the prostate specific antigen mixture injection every day; and S4, continuing to feed all the experimental rats in the groups until the 28th day, wherein the experimental rats in the low-dose model group and the high-dose model group are induced by the prostate specific antigen mixture to cause experimental autoimmune prostatitis, and an experimental autoimmune prostatitis rat model is obtained. The method can not only reduce the use of animals and the cost, but also improve the modeling efficiency and stability.

Discovery and application of desmin autoantibody as a marker of nervous system disease

PendingCN122449133AImmunologic disordersDesmin
The application discloses discovery and application of desmin autoantibody as a marker of nervous system diseases. The application finds that only the fluorescent signal existing in the nervous system disease patients but not in the healthy people, and the fluorescent mode of the IgG related autoimmune antibody in the mouse brain tissue section is different, which indicates that the patient may have autoimmune antibody. Through the immunoprecipitation technology, the IgG specific protein related to the nervous system disease is sought, the specific desmin autoantibody is found by adopting the CBA mode, and then the desmin autoantibody is verified in the cerebrospinal fluid, so that it is finally determined that the desmin autoantibody can be used as a specific marker for diagnosing the nervous system autoimmune diseases. The expression of the desmin autoantibody is detected by taking the desmin as a detection antigen, and the detection of the desmin autoantibody can be applied to a kit for detecting the desmin autoantibody, and can be applied to the detection of the nervous system diseases, so that the marker for identifying the nervous system diseases is enriched, and the accuracy of the detection of the nervous system related diseases is improved.

Medicine for relieving autoimmune prostatitis and application thereof

PendingCN122440679APharmaceutical medicineAutoimmunity
The application relates to the field of biological medicine, and discloses a medicine for relieving autoimmune prostatitis and application thereof, which comprises an active ingredient and a pharmaceutically acceptable sterile phosphate buffer carrier; the active ingredient is live Lactobacillus johnsonii with a number of BNCC135265 or extracellular vesicles of Lactobacillus johnsonii; the final concentration of live bacteria in the medicine is 1x10 8 to 1x10 10 CFU / mL, which is used for preparing a preparation for intragastric administration; the extracellular vesicles contain 1x10 8 to 5x10 9 particles per unit dosage form, which is used for preparing a preparation for tail vein injection administration. By using the live bacteria with the specific number or the extracellular vesicles thereof, intestinal mucosa colonization can be achieved to block endotoxin into blood, or the extracellular vesicles can be enriched in prostate lesions to inhibit a nuclear factor-kappa B inflammatory signaling pathway, reduce synthesis of proinflammatory cytokines and lymphocyte infiltration, and finally realize relief of autoimmune prostatitis.
